Dang....before I laid out that kind of cash, I would want to drain/replace the fluids in both the read end (w/posi additive if appropriate) and the transmission. Both use gear lube in 1970 (no posi additive in transmission), PLUS, take a really hard look at my u-joints & re-grease them too (if you have fittings on them).
